Exploring the Bitcoin Landscape: Address Lookup Made Simple

Unveiling the mysteries of the Bitcoin blockchain can feel like traversing a complex labyrinth. Addresses, those cryptic strings of characters, often stand as the primary barrier for newcomers. But fear not, intrepid explorer! There are tools and techniques at your disposal to make address lookup a breeze.

Whether you're looking for a specific wallet or simply curious about a particular address' history, these resources can provide invaluable insight. From dedicated blockchain explorers to user-friendly interfaces, navigating the Bitcoin landscape has never been more convenient.

  • Launch your exploration with a reputable blockchain explorer like Blockchain.com or Blockchair. These platforms offer intuitive interfaces for searching and viewing transaction history associated with any given Bitcoin address.
  • Utilize advanced search features to filter your results based on specific criteria, such as transaction amounts or dates.
  • Keep up-to-date about security best practices and potential scams. Only use trusted resources and be cautious of unsolicited requests for personal information.

Securing Your Satoshi Stash: Best Practices for Bitcoin Account Management

Your Satoshi is valuable, so protecting it should be a top priority. Employ these best practices to safeguard your digital assets and ensure long-term security.

Start with a robust password that's unique to your Bitcoin wallet. Avoid common passwords and use a combination of uppercase and lowercase symbols. Enable two-factor authentication (copyright) for an added level of security. copyright requires a second form of verification, such as a code from your phone, in addition to your password.

Hold your Bitcoin wallet on a hardware device whenever possible. Hardware wallets are dedicated devices that provide enhanced security check here compared to software wallets stored on your computer or phone.

Be cautious of fraud. Never share your private keys or seed phrase with anyone, and be wary of suspicious emails or websites. Only download Bitcoin wallets from trusted developers. Regularly update your wallet software to patch any vulnerabilities.
